The possibility of reducing the number of animals in sensitization studies (maximization method) is discussed on the basis of results from 20 sensitization tests. It appears that the number of test animals in sensitization studies may be reduced to ten treated animals and five control animals without prejudice to the quality of the test. 相似文献

Ultraviolet Laser-Induced Fluorescence Spectroscopy Diagnosis of Human Stomach Malignant Tissues 总被引:2,自引:0,他引:2
To evaluate the potential of laser-induced autofluorescence spectroscopy for the detection of premalignant lesions of human
stomach, fluorescence properties of stomach tissues have been investigated in vitro and in vivo. A specially made optical
fibre probe and the multichannel fluorescence collection system have been used successfully in our research.

Determination of tissue optical properties by steady-state spatial frequency-domain reflectometry 总被引:1,自引:0,他引:1
A new non-invasive method to measure the optical properties of biological tissue is described. This method consists of illuminating the investigated sample with light which is spatially periodically modulated in intensity. The spatial modulation of the backscattered light and the diffuse reflectivity of the sample, both detected with an imaging technique, are used to deduce the absorption and reduced scattering coefficient from a table generated by Monte Carlo simulations. This principle has three major advantages: Firstly, it permits the immediate acquisition of the average values of the optical coefficients over a relatively large area (typ. 20 mm in diameter), thus avoiding the perturbations generated by small tissue heterogeneities; It also provides good flexibility for measuring the optical coefficients at various wavelengths and it does not require the use of a detector with a large dynamic range. The method was first validated on phantoms with known optical properties. Finally, we measured the optical properties of human skin at 400 nm, 500 nm, 633 nm and 700 nm in vivo. 相似文献

介绍中指近节背侧岛状皮瓣的应用解剖,该皮瓣的营养动脉为第2掌背动脉,位置表浅,解剖容易,安全可靠。自1990年11月以来,应用该皮瓣修复手部软组织缺损共6例,均获成功。 相似文献

Current European Community (Annex V) guidelines recommend the use of 20 test animals in the guinea pig maximisation test for skin sensitisation. The suitability, for classification and labelling purposes, of reducing the number of test animals has been examined by analysing the results of 40 studies submitted to the Health and Safety Executive, and by the use of a mathematical model. Our results suggest that in most cases an experiment with ten test animals can be used to determine satisfactorily whether a substance should be labelled with the risk phrase may cause sensitisation by skin contact. However, serious consideration should be given to the need for additional investigation if two or three of the ten test animals show a sensitisation response. The highest nonirritant concentration of a substance should be used at challenge. Clearer guidance in Annex V on evaluating challenge responses would be beneficial. 相似文献

Summary The data collected by the authors in four experimental series have been analysed together with data from the literature, to
study the relationship between mean skin temperature and climatic parameters, subject metabolic rate and clothing insulation.
The subjects involved in the various studies were young male subjects, unacclimatized to heat. The range of conditions examined
involved mean skin temperatures between 33‡ C and 38‡ C, air temperatures (Ta) between 23‡ C and 50‡ C, ambient water vapour pressures (Pa) between 1 and 4.8 kPa, air velocities (Va) between 0.2 and 0.9 m · s−1, metabolic rates (M) between 50 and 270 W · m−2, and Clo values between 0.1 and 0.6. In 95% of the data, mean radiant temperature was within ±3‡ C of air temperature. Based
on 190 data averaged over individual values, the following equation was derived by a multiple linear regression technique:
ˉTsk=30.0+0.138Ta+0.254Pa−0.57Va+1.28 · 10−3 M−0.553 Clo. This equation was used to predict mean skin temperature from 629 individual data. The difference between observed
and predicted values was within ±0.6‡ C in 70% of the cases and within ±1‡ C in 90% of the cases. It is concluded that the
proposed formula may be used to predict mean skin temperature with satisfactory accuracy in nude to lightly clad subjects
exposed to warm ambient conditions with no significant radiant heat load. 相似文献

The purpose of this study was to elucidate the effect of raised body temperature per se during acute heat stress on the spontaneous
arterial baroreflex control of heart rate (f
c) in humans. To investigate whether unloading of cardiopulmonary baroreceptors during whole-body heating would alter the arterial
baroreflex control of f
c, we controlled loading of the cardiopulmonary baroreceptors by head-down tilt (HDT) at angles of 5°, 10°, 15°, and 30° during
heat stress produced by hot-water-perfused suits. The sensitivity of the arterial baroreceptor-cardiac reflex was calculated
from the spontaneous changes in beat-to-beat arterial pressure and f
c. As an index of cardiopulmonary baroreceptor loading, the left atrial diameter (LAD) was measured by echocardiography. During
whole-body heating, the LAD decreased with the rising body core temperature and increased with the HDT. The decreased LAD
during heating almost recovered to the normothermic control level by 10° HDT. In the supine position, cardiac baroreflex sensitivity
remained unchanged during heating. Arterial pressure, f
c and cardiac baroreflex sensitivity were not changed by HDT ranging from 5° to 30° during heating. These results suggest that
cardiac baroreflex sensitivity remain unchanged during graded loading of the cardiopulmonary baroreceptors in heat-stressed
humans. Also, we conclude that the sensitivity of the spontaneous arterial baroreflex controlling the f
c is not influenced by raised body temperature per se during acute heat stress.

Objective and Design: Whilst the anti-microbial properties of tea tree oil (TTO) are established, the anti-inflammatory effects of TTO in human skin remain largely anecdotal and require evaluation. This study examined the effect of topically applied TTO on nickel-induced contact hypersensitivity reactions in human dorsal skin.Treatment: TTO (100%), a 5% TTO lotion, a placebo lotion (no TTO), or 100% macadamia oil were applied at days 3 and 5 after nickel exposure.Methods: The flare area and erythema index were measured on days 3, 5 and 7. The regulatory effects of TTO were also investigated on the proliferative response to nickel or polyclonal mitogens by peripheral blood mononuclear cells from nickel-sensitive and control subjects.Results: TTO (100%) significantly reduced the flare area and erythema index when compared to the nickel-only sites. With respect to the erythema index, the anti-inflammatory effects were predominantly, but not exclusively, seen in a subgroup of nickel-sensitive subjects with a prolonged development phase of nickel-induced contact hypersensitivity response. The 5% TTO lotion, the placebo lotion and the 100% macadamia oil were all without significant effect. TTO significantly inhibited proliferation to nickel but not to non-specific polyclonal mitogens by peripheral blood mononuclear cells from nickel-sensitive subjects.Conclusions: Topical application of 100% TTO may have therapeutic benefit in nickel-induced contact hypersensitivity in human skin. A cytoplasmic component of pyridine nucleotide fluorescence in rat diaphragm: evidence from comparisons with flavoprotein fluorescence 总被引:1,自引:0,他引:1
Brian M. Paddle 《Pflügers Archiv : European journal of physiology》1985,404(4):326-331
Pyridine nucleotide (PN) and flavoprotein (Fp) fluorescence were monitored in the isolated intact rat diaphragm. A substantial increase in PN fluorescence occurred when N2 replaced O2 in glucose medium. This response was much reduced in pyruvate medium and/or by pretreatment with iodoacetic acid (IAA). The anaerobic levels of Fp fluorescence were less affected by substrate and IAA. Substitution of glucose by pyruvate did not alter the PN fluorescence of the resting aerobic tissue, but increased Fp fluorescence. After a tetanus with glucose present the PN of the anaerobic muscle, but not the Fp underwent a substantial transient oxidation. This oxidation was absent in pyruvate medium. It is concluded that a cytoplasmic component of the PN fluorescence is present in skeletal muscle. The levels of Fp fluorescence in the resting and contracting aerobic tissue supplied with pyruvate suggest that the resting tissue respiration was ADP limited. On this basis the level of PN fluorescence in the aerobic resting state was less than expected; the source of the PN fluorescence was both mitochondrial and cytoplasmic. 相似文献

Summary The phenomena of stress-relaxation and capillary outward filtration were studied in the isolated rabbit ear, perfused with blood at constant flow. The volume increase, as measured by the plethysmograph, following elevation of venous outflow pressure to 20 mm Hg for 4 min was predominantly due to capillary outward filtration in the norepinephrine constricted vascular bed (0.5 g/min). With papaverine induced dilatation (0.08 mg/min) this persistent volume increase could be attributed mainly to stress-relaxation of the veins. Engorgement of venous vessels as well as capillary outward filtration led to an increase of the ear volume that is measured by the plethysmographic technique. The photographic-photoelectric measurement of venous diameter changes was used in these experiments to distinguish intravascular from extravascular volume changes. The moduli of volume elasticity were calculated for smaller and larger veins (mean diameter 0.133 mm and 0.553 mm) with norepinephrine constriction.
